Thank you for this in depth review. My interest is in having this converted to a class B RV. With that in mind, I would be most interested in the high roof option. To your knowledge, that the high roof cause any legal limitations in the road? I have the same question with the dual rear wheels. What are the downsides with this selection? Thank you vert much.
@CarsWithSteve
Жыл бұрын
You're welcome! No limitations with the high roof as far as I know.. these things are converted all the time, they're driven on streets all over North America without issue. When you get the dual wheels there are a few pros and cons.. Pros: more stability to the ride, higher GVWR Cons: slightly worse fuel economy, losing a bit of rear interior space If you don't absolutely need the dually for increased weight the single wheel is probably more than enough!

What is the difference between 150, 250, 350? Thanks, great, informative walkthrough btw.
@CarsWithSteve
Жыл бұрын
Thanks! Payload, towing and GVWR are really the key differences between them. Outside of that the body styles would be exactly the same

I dont see an option for just wall paneling....instead its in a package with vinyl flooring. But I want heavy duty flooring with wall panels.
@CarsWithSteve
Жыл бұрын
You'd have to look at adding both Interior Upgrade Package (96c) or Load Area Protection Package (96d) and the Heavy Duty Flooring (60b). The heavy duty flooring would replace the vinyl flooring when you get them together
